#4c38d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c38dd is composed of 29.8% red, 22%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 247.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4c38dd color hex could be obtained by blending #9870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4c38d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c38dd has RGB values of R:76, G:56,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4995293.

Shades and Tints of #4c38d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c38d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89898c is the less saturated color, while #381df8 is the most saturated one.
